comsolMultiphysics®中中划分是否并运行运行运行

2019年5月3日

你有没有,模型没有的的拓扑,换的,换话,将话,将将话说几何体几何体分解分解为域,边界,边和和顶点等等几何几何®软件中生成计算资源使用?如果如果是,那么那么你可能可能会对本本篇篇

comsol多物理学®中中并行网格

以下以下共享:享内存并:

  • 自由四面体
  • 自由三角形
  • 自由四四形
  • 映射
  • 边界层
  • 扫掠

自由四是面面行操作这意味着当此操作操作在一个个具有具有四四四个个个个域域的几何几何几何几何上生成生成生成四面体面体四四四面体面体四生成四面体面体面体面体时个个个个个能使用个内内核核核内不管多少内核可。类似类似类似类似地自由自由自由四边映射操作操作二维域三维面之间是并行的

边界层操作是并行其他操作操作,这其他不同网格在每每域域内

最后,作为扫描操作的,连接面连接面网格划分(通过映射((((())是是并行的。

请请,在操作序列,网格的序列而而而下

基准示例性能

在实际实际,并并的网格划分加快多少时间?我们取取个6m×1m×1m的,在在台有台个的电脑上网格划分划分网格下添加一自由四操作。测试中,使用使用以下网格单元参数参数

  • 最大::0.02 m
  • 最小::0.01 m

comsolMultiphysics®中网格大小的设置窗口的屏幕截图。
基准示例测试中使用网格大小设置

这些这些非常精细的的,从而从而从而产生产生了了了了了万万万万个四

我们我们三个测试测试,其中其中模型:

  1. 一个
  2. 六个,将将划分为个域等
  3. 六个,限制限制只能一运行内
用于评估并行运行基准的的图像图像
划分划分个相域的块几何示意图何示意图

左左:具有1个域6 m×1 m×1 m块块情况1()。:与:与情况1具有具有大小几何几何,但但但但6个大小1 m×1 m×1 m的的(情况23)。

为了限制仅一个内,可以核上,可以将选项选项-np 1添加添加启动命令也可以可以首首对话框多核核集群页面页面执行此操作

基准基准测试结果和

3次的结果在下表下表中。。。。。情况。。。中中网格将将将仅将将将将仅仅仅仅个在个个个个个个个3)具有多的,因此因此产生的的,这的三角形,这这意味意味着着该该几何几何结构结构结构更需要更多多多的的的的的网格划分划分划分划分划分工作工作。。25%以下以下以下使用使用到仅到到使用一以下以下

情况 时间 三角形三角形 四面体
1 1 136 s 1.51E3 13.0E6
2 6 31 s 1.81e3 13.0E6
3(1核) 6 147 s 1.81e3 13.0E6

(((((())((())

你可能知道应该几何体划分为与多多的,假设的的的的的的时时的域域较少少:没有

对域进行导致多的边界。这就网格更多的,反多的多多多多多的多,反反反,这反反过来划分,通过通过和和和中和时间和,我们和,我们可以清楚的看到看到看到这一点应该应该应该应该应该应该示例理想化,即是是即六有六个相等域域。。在在在实际下在实际,更实际在在在,更更更更更更更有有可能可能可能可能的域

使用边界层

边界层操作在单元时平行移动点,甚至平行平行平行平行单单个上上上操作操作操作也可以操作也也可以可以可以可以这样这样这样可以这样这样这样这样这样这样这样做做做做做做做做做做做做做做

我我多少个操作而不损失性能性能

2(示例的中的的的(((多六六六个个个个个个域个个个个个个个个个个个个个个来来来来来来来来来来。。并并行化行化行化网格按的进行的自由四,并,并每操作对三网格网格网格,则,则最多可以可以可以使用三三个。说一般一般一般一般来来一般。。化,而且而且很地优化网格质量要在的的的域或边界上上设置设置不同的不同不同的自由四操作。使用网格划分教程模型中有关设置全局局部尺寸属性的细节细节

网格网格并行的总结性总结性

在这博客博客加快算算速度

推荐推荐

有关自由四操作的多信息,以及修改的可能

博客博客


评论(0)

留言
登录|注册
正在... ...
浏览comsol博客